Requirements

  • MSc or PhD in Chemistry, Biochemistry, Physics, or related scientific discipline.
  • At least 5 years of direct laboratory experience in an academic or industrial R&D environment.
  • Experience leading teams in a lab or technical setting.
  • Strong communication skills and fluency in English.
  • US work authorization (required).
  • Willingness to relocate to Westborough, MA.

Responsibilities

  • Ensure safe, efficient operations for all teams using the laboratory, following company policies and lab guidelines.
  • Inspire your team with clear guidance, integrity, and a growth mindset.
  • Lead and develop technical talent: set objectives, create development plans, and champion high performance.
  • Coordinate laboratory activities, scheduling, systems, and resources for maximum efficiency.
  • Implement business strategy and offer process and workflow improvement recommendations.
  • Support customers through technical expertise, helping resolve sample prep, calibration, validation, and applications issues virtually or onsite.
  • Deliver technical presentations, contribute to value propositions, maintain CRM data, and support customers in their buying journey.
  • Provide sample analysis and clear written/oral reports for proof‑of‑concept and method development studies.
  • Demonstrate system usage (remote, onsite, or at Malvern Panalytical facilities).
  • Provide training and applications expertise to new and existing customers.
  • Travel up to 15% overnight within the US.
